Solar-Powered Water Disinfection Device

Sep 11 2013

Easy to handle, reliable and cost-efficient – in a nutshell, these are the characteristics that make the WADI unique. This solar-powered water disinfection device can be easily screwed onto PET bottles. The UV rays destroy viruses and bacteria. As soon as a smiley appears on the WADI, the water is germfree and thus drinkable. The most important target markets are economically disadvantaged regions in Africa and Asia. This is why it was of special concern to the inventor of the WADI, Martin Wesian, to develop a product that has a high service life at a low price. His collaboration with Lenzing Technik (Austria), who relies on a sophisticated manufacturing technology, has made this combination possible. No later than in October this year, production of the first 200,000 WADIs will start at the Austrian Schörfling plant, which is the mechatronics site of Lenzing Technik GmbH.

According to the motto “Buy two, donate one”, the WADI, which stands for Water Disinfection, will be sold in the USA and Europe. “This means that you buy two units and automatically donate one to those regions where the WADI is desperately needed”, clarifies the inventor of the WADI, the Austrian Martin Wesian. In order to establish the WADI‘s sustainably positive effect, Helioz is looking for supporters all over the world via the crowd-funding platform Indiegogo. After having relied on Lenzing Technik’s expertise in terms of design and the search for suitable materials, Wesian’s distributor Helioz signed the contract for ready-to-ship products with Lenzing Technik GmbH a few days ago. So far, the Mechatronics Unit of Lenzing Technik has produced the circuit board for the WADI. “When doing so, the Lenzing team has proved highly professional and reliable. Lenzing Technik has outstanding international experience, another reason why it has been our preferred partner for production”, emphasizes Wesian.

The main challenge for the mechatronics team at Lenzing Technik was to combine the longest possible service life with cost efficiency and at the same time to develop products that are ready to ship. “Given that the WADI is produced for individuals who can’t take the constant availability of drinking water for granted, we are specially pleased to offer a device that works reliably for years“, declares Herbert Hummer, Managing Director of Lenzing Technik. At the Schörfling site, a newly developed, fully automated test and calibration bench ensures a rigorous quality control. The WADI is manufactured, assembled and packed for shipping by Lenzing Technik.
